On Thu, 20 Feb 2025 12:15:40 +0100 Jiri Slaby (SUSE) wrote:
> N_TTY_BUF_SIZE -- as the name suggests -- is the N_TTY's buffer size.
> There is no reason to couple that to caif's tty->receive_room. Use 4096
> directly -- even though, it should be some sort of "SKB_MAX_ALLOC" or
> alike. But definitely not N_TTY_BUF_SIZE.
> 
> N_TTY_BUF_SIZE is private and will be moved to n_tty.c later.
